Why Is Monitoring Your Blood Pressure at Home Crucial for Your Health?

High blood pressure, or hypertension, often goes unnoticed until it causes significant health problems. By regularly monitoring your blood pressure at home, you can detect early signs of hypertension, manage existing conditions, and prevent severe complications. Benefits of Home Blood Pressure Monitoring

1. Track Changes Over Time

At-home monitoring helps you keep track of how your blood pressure varies daily, weekly, or monthly. Key benefits include:

  • Identifying trends, such as spikes during stress or after consuming salty foods.

  • Understanding the impact of lifestyle changes like diet or exercise.

  • Sharing comprehensive data with your healthcare provider for more accurate diagnoses.

2. Avoid White-Coat Syndrome

For some individuals, visiting a medical professional can cause stress, leading to temporarily elevated readings, known as "white-coat syndrome." Monitoring at home allows you to:

  • Measure blood pressure in a relaxed environment.

  • Get accurate readings that reflect your typical state.

  • Reduce anxiety associated with medical visits.

3. Manage Hypertension More Effectively

For individuals diagnosed with hypertension, home monitoring is invaluable. It helps with:

  • Medication Management: Determine if your treatment plan is effective.

  • Behavioral Adjustments: Make necessary changes to diet, exercise, or stress levels.

  • Emergency Alerts: Detects dangerously high or low blood pressure levels quickly.

How to Measure Blood Pressure at Home

To get accurate readings, follow these tips:

  • Use a Reliable Device: Invest in an approved and calibrated home blood pressure monitor.

  • Follow Proper Technique:

    • Sit comfortably with your back supported and feet flat on the ground.

    • Place the cuff on your upper arm at heart level.

    • Avoid talking or moving during the measurement.

  • Take Multiple Readings: Measure at the same time daily and average the results.

The Long-Term Health Benefits

1. Preventing Serious Conditions

Consistent monitoring can help prevent complications such as:

  • Heart disease

  • Stroke

  • Kidney damage

2. Promoting Healthy Lifestyle Choices

Knowing your numbers motivates you to:

  • Adopt a balanced diet low in sodium.

  • Engage in regular physical activity.

  • Manage stress through relaxation techniques.
